  • OCTOBER 2005 : The League of California Cities grants the prestigious Helen Putnam Award to the City of Beverly Hills for its implementation of the Online Business Center (OBC), powered by Edgesoft's Enterprise Land Management System (eLMS™). The award was presented at the League of California Cities Annual Conference at the Moscone Center West, San Francisco, October 6 -7, 2005.

  • OCTOBER 2005 : The Online Business Center (OBC) wins the Government Computer News (GCN) Agency Award  for the City of Beverly Hills. The award was presented at the annual GCN Awards in Washington D.C. on October 11, 2005. GCN is a leading source for news and state-of-the-art technology at all levels of government.

  • OCTOBER 2005 : Entitled "Star System", an article on the Online Business Center (OBC) was featured in the October 10th issue (Vol. 24 No. 30) of Government Computer News (GCN). The article describes how the development of the OBC addressed the challenges faced by the City of Beverly Hills' former IT infrastructure and saved the City more than $260,000 in four departments alone in its first year.

  • JULY 2005 : The City of Burbank selects Edgesoft's Enterprise Land Management System (eLMS™) as the enterprise-wide solution for implementing their Land Data Management Plan (LDMP) initiatives. The basic eLMS™ framework and the Code Enforcement Module are being deployed as Phase I. This phase is part of a three-year LDMP initiative.

  • JUNE 2005 : An article on the Online Business Center (OBC) was featured in Western City Magazine's June 2005 edition. The article describes how the City of Beverly Hills was able to address its need for a Web-based, forward-thinking software solution by implementing the OBC.
